iSAM Funds UK Ltd Makes New $2.93 Million Investment in Citizens Financial Group, Inc. $CFG

iSAM Funds UK Ltd bought a new position in shares of Citizens Financial Group, Inc. (NYSE:CFGFree Report) during the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or bought 41,800 shares of the bank’s stock, valued at approximately $2,929,000. Citizens Financial Group makes up approximately 2.1% of iSAM Funds UK Ltd’s portfolio, making the stock its 2nd biggest position.

Insider Transactions at Citizens Financial Group

In other news, CEO Saun Bruce Van sold 129,369 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Friday, July 24th. The shares were sold at an average price of $72.07, for a total transaction of $9,323,623.83. Following the completion of the sale, the chief executive officer owned 1,140,763 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$82,214,789.41. This represents a 10.19% decrease in their ownership of the stock. Citizens Financial Group Price Performance

Shares of Citizens Financial Group stock opened at $69.74 on Thursday. The stock has a market capitalization of $29.37 billion, a P/E ratio of 15.13, a PEG ratio of 0.62 and a beta of 0.66. The business has a 50 day simple moving average of $71.46 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$65.73. Citizens Financial Group, Inc. has a 12 month low of $47.96 and a 12 month high of $75.33.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.63, a current ratio of 0.86 and a quick ratio of 0.85.

Citizens Financial Group (NYSE:CFGG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, July 16th. The bank reported $1.30 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.25 by $0.05. Citizens Financial Group had a return on equity of 8.85% and a net margin of 17.18%.The firm had revenue of $2.28 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$2.25 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$0.92 earnings per share. The business’s revenue was up 12.1%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, analysts predict that Citizens Financial Group, Inc. will post 5.3 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Citizens Financial Group Profile

(Free Report)

Citizens Financial Group, Inc (NYSE: CFG) is a bank holding company that provides a broad range of banking and financial services to individuals, small and middle-market businesses, corporations and institutional clients. Headquartered in Providence, Rhode Island, Citizens conducts its banking operations principally through its primary banking subsidiary, Citizens Bank, and serves customers through a combination of branch locations, ATMs and digital channels.
